CBF Furnace

Design temperatureMax. 1250°C
Temperature difference±3~10°C at Vertical and ±10°C Horizontal
Temperature accuracy±1~5℃
Heating rate0.5~10℃/h adjustable
Cooling rate2℃–15℃/h adjustable
Power consumption4.2-6.0 GJ/T baked product for primary baking
2.5-3.5 GJ/T baked product for secondary baking
ApplicationPrimary baking and secondary baking for Carbon Cathode, UHP electrode and Isostatic graphite

Tunnel Furnace

Design temperatureMax. 1050°C
Calcination cycle288~336h;
Energy consumption1.8GJ/baked product for secondary baking
Loading wayNeed saggar or crucible
ApplicationSecondary baking for UHP electrode and precarbonization process for anode material.

Pit-ring Furnace with Cover

Design temperatureMax. 1100°C
Qty. of Pit4-5 pits per furnace
Qty. of Fire control system2-3 pcs
Qty. of heating section7-8 pcs
Temperature difference±50℃ Vertical
Fire cycle42-45h
Loading wayStand loaded
Packing MaterialCPC coke for primary baking
Without packing material for secondary baking
Power consumption2.8 GJ/T baked product for primary baking
1.8 GJ/T baked product for secondary baking
ApplicationPrimary baking and secondary baking for Carbon Cathode, UHP electrode
